3D Printing in Dental Surgery



To boost the area of dental surgery, you can explore the subtopic of 3D printing in dental surgery. This innovative innovation has the potential to change the method dental surgeons run and deal with people. Right here are four crucial ways in which 3D printing is shaping the area:

- ** Custom-made Surgical Guides **: 3D printing enables the production of highly precise and patient-specific medical guides, improving the accuracy and efficiency of procedures.

- ** Implant Prosthetics **: With 3D printing, oral surgeons can develop tailored implant prosthetics that perfectly fit a client's unique anatomy, resulting in much better results and individual contentment.

- ** Bone Grafting **: 3D printing enables the manufacturing of patient-specific bone grafts, reducing the need for typical implanting methods and improving recovery and recovery time.

- ** Education and Training **: 3D printing can be utilized to create realistic surgical versions for academic purposes, enabling oral surgeons to exercise complex treatments prior to executing them on people.

With its prospective to enhance accuracy, personalization, and training, 3D printing is an amazing advancement in the field of dental surgery.

Minimally Intrusive Methods



To even more progress the area of dental surgery, accept the capacity of minimally intrusive techniques that can considerably profit both surgeons and individuals alike.

Minimally invasive techniques are revolutionizing the field by lowering medical trauma, reducing post-operative discomfort, and accelerating the recovery procedure. These strategies include utilizing smaller incisions and specialized instruments to do treatments with accuracy and performance.

By utilizing innovative imaging technology, such as cone beam of light calculated tomography (CBCT), surgeons can precisely plan and execute surgeries with minimal invasiveness.

In addition, using lasers in dental surgery enables exact tissue cutting and coagulation, causing lessened bleeding and minimized recovery time.

With minimally invasive strategies, clients can experience much faster recuperation, decreased scarring, and boosted end results, making it a vital facet of the future of dental surgery.
